With the current pace of construction in Ontario, there is a high demand for skilled equipment operators to support this industry. Completion of the Heavy Construction Equipment Operation program will position you for success in the industry.

This program includes a significant amount of hands-on experience, safely performing basic maintenance and operating various pieces of large equipment at one of our two program locations (Guelph or Brantford Airport). You will also be exposed to compact equipment and paving operations. This practical experience is complemented with related theory including environmental practices, soils, concrete and asphalt, surveying and site plans.

By the end of the program, you will be well-prepared for success as you enter employment in the heavy construction and paving industries as an equipment operator. As a graduate of this program, you will have the opportunity to receive automatic exemption from all of the apprenticeship in-school training for the three Heavy Equipment Operator trades (Tractor-Loader-Backhoe, Excavator, Dozer) should you choose to pursue that career pathway.
